Boon Tong Kee Location

Boon Tong Kee is located at Second Floor, UP Town Center, Katipunan Avenue, Diliman, Quezon City. This is a Seafood restaurant near the UP Town Center.The average price range at Boon Tong Kee is around ₱ 400 / Person,and the opening hours are 8:00 - 18:00.Boon Tong Kee is a well-known gourmet restaurant in the UP Town Center area. There are different kinds of food in Boon Tong Kee that are worth trying. If you have any questions,please contact +6329552292, +639156624406.

    On the table:1. Thick soup with crab meat and sweet corn- a little salty with a few corn kernels and small shreds or crab meat.2. Imperial pork ribs- sweet and very tender. Very nice presentation too.3. Fish fillet with ginger and spring onions- very light but not bland. I liked it.4. Chicken rice- really good.5. Yimian prawns- this is a noodle dish with thick sauce. Very flavorful. However, this came with only 3 halved shrimps. They should name this something else.

    Prolly the closest hainanese chicken you can get to the singapore ones. The food was so-so. Some were good, and some i didn't care for.The pork buns didn't even come close to those of tuantuan or tim ho wan. They were "bready' and soggy; and the filling was too gelatinous for me. The hakaw was okay. The shrimps were fresh but the rice wrapper seemed old and crumbly. My dad didnt like the sausage buns that he had because they were bland and gritty. What we liked most was the wanton noodle soup. The noodles were firm and soup was flavourful.It wont be my first choice for dimsum, but id come back for their roast chicken and cereal prawns instead.
